Montgomery College is the largest community college in Maryland, founded in 1946, serving 55,000+ students across Rockville, Germantown, and Takoma Park campuses. One of the most internationally diverse community colleges in the US, MC serves Montgomery County — home to the NIH, FDA, and the largest biotech cluster on the East Coast outside of Boston.
